The Organisation

Founded in 1951, the Refugee Council exists to support people who come to the UK in need of safety and speak out for compassion, fairness and kindness. We achieve this by providing expert advice and casework, building the capacity of refugee community organisations, and working with allies across society to change government policy.

Our vision for refugees to be welcome to live safe and fulfilling lives contributing to the UK has never been more urgent and needed. Today, 27 million refugees and 84 million displaced people around the world are in need of safety and dignity and to be made to feel welcome. We are determined to secure public and government support for safe routes for all people seeking safety and a fair, effective and compassionate refugee protection system.

Context and Purpose of the Job

The resettlement team provides advice and support for resettled refugees to help them access services and mainstream provision and establish community links. Working closely with local stakeholders and in partnership with other voluntary sector agencies running similar services across the UK, the Refugee Council resettlement team promotes both the integration and independence of this group.

The Refugee Council has agreed to work in partnership with Migration Yorkshire and Local Authorities across Yorkshire and Humberside to deliver the regional resettlement programmes.

Main Duties and Responsibilities

  • To enable newly arrived refugees to identify their needs and aspirations and play an active role in fulfilling them.
  • To assist resettled refugees in developing and taking part in social, cultural, recreational and other community activities.
  • To develop community development initiatives that promote links between resettled refugees and the wider community, including established refugee communities.
  • To promote the successful integration of resettled refugees through community initiatives that may include key factors such as health, employment, housing, education and training.
